Title :
Single-mode Yb-doped fiber laser at 980 nm for efficient frequency-doubling

Abstract :
A single-mode Yb-doped fiber laser producing 1 W at 980 nm is demonstrated with a high conversion efficiency of 66%. A 58 mW power at 489 nm is reported by frequency-doubling in a ppLN waveguide.
